Opera 10.53 Unix Beta (1)- Flash error and RAM hog

Hey sorry in advance if I'm not supposed to post here. I've been testing out 10.53 for Linux/Unix and I have a few problems. When I watch too many flash videos it seems Opera 10.53 Linux/Unix uses too much RAM and it never seems to be reduced. Also after watching many flash videos (such as on youtube) and expanding these videos on fullscreen it hangs in fullscreen and the bottom menu doesn't pop-up making it impossible to exit fullscreen mode. Also note I've been testing Adobe's Flash 10.1 RC2. I am using Mandriva 2010.0, Gnome 2.28.0. Thanks for your support and thanks for the releases for Unix and Unix-Like systems! bigsmile
